My Son Paid for Me during Our Family Trip but Then His Ultimatum Just Killed Me

Linda, a grandmother who cherished moments of solitude amidst the joyful chaos of her grandsons’ visits, found herself at the center of a familial storm during a planned vacation with her son, Gideon, and his family. Initially thrilled by Gideon’s generous invitation, Linda packed her bags eagerly, looking forward to quality time with her loved ones.

Gideon’s offer to cover all expenses for the family trip seemed like a dream come true for Linda, who hesitated initially due to concerns about financial responsibility and the suitability of the destination for young children. However, reassured by Gideon’s assurances and the promise of a family-focused vacation, Linda accepted the invitation on the condition that she would not be responsible for babysitting duties during the trip.

As the vacation unfolded, Linda reveled in the cultural experiences and cherished moments with her grandsons during the day. However, tensions arose when Gideon approached her with a request to babysit the children in the evenings, disrupting the agreed-upon arrangement. Despite Linda’s attempts to assert her boundaries and remind Gideon of their agreement, he insisted that she help out, leading to a heated confrontation that left Linda feeling hurt and betrayed.

Faced with the painful choice between compromising her boundaries and standing firm in her convictions, Linda made the difficult decision to leave the vacation early, opting to prioritize her emotional well-being over familial expectations. Despite facing backlash from Gideon and his family, Linda remained steadfast in her belief that self-respect and personal boundaries were non-negotiable.

In the aftermath of the vacation debacle, Linda grappled with feelings of guilt and uncertainty, questioning whether she had overreacted or acted in haste. However, she remained resolute in her decision, recognizing the importance of advocating for her needs and asserting her autonomy within familial relationships.

Ultimately, Linda’s story serves as a poignant reminder of the complexities inherent in navigating family dynamics and the importance of prioritizing self-care and emotional well-being, even in the face of familial pressure and expectations.
